Rick Shea was appointed to the board in 2015 and elected by the community to retain the seat in 2016. He represents District 5, which runs along the coast from Del Mar to Camp Pendleton and includes some inland North County areas.
Shea retired as the special assistant to the county superintendent/administrative services officer for the San Diego County Office of Education. Before that he served as a classroom teacher, head teacher for the Juvenile Court Schools, and as a juvenile probation officer. Shea has also served on the Encinitas City Council, Encinitas Fire Protection District, San Dieguito Water District, Cardiff by the Sea Sanitation District, and North County Transit District.
He lives in Encinitas, and has lived in District 5 for more than 40 years.

The San Diego County Office of Education (SDCOE) is inspiring and leading innovation in education so that all students can thrive in a future without boundaries. The County Office helps the county’s school districts operate efficiently and with significant cost savings by leveraging resources to perform personnel tasks and provide staff development and other services. With a focus on equity, innovation, and career technical education, SDCOE directly educates more than 3,000 students at more than 20 sites each year and provides support services to more than 500,000 students across 42 school districts.
